Transaction

dde6aa4e5e4f7dc197d6d880825f39cb3e8ae648ee7900c1ea7dd9fdf81ddcee
429,973 confirmations
Timestamp
1519514048
Block510,749
Fee22,253 sats
Fee rate62 sats/vB
view on mempool.space

Inputs & Outputs